机械工程专业英语 第3版 [唐一平 著]

机械工程专业英语 第3版  
作者:唐一平 著  
出版时间:2017年版 
内容简介 
  本教材专为普通工科院校机械工程专业类本科生编写,内容涵盖了常规及超级工程材料,常规和特种机械加工技术,公差与配合以及定位和夹具,齿轮及液压传动,直接传动,高速切削加工和数控技术及数控加工中心,自动控制,传感器和机器人技术,3D打印技术。附录还包括了英文摘要写作,国外工科名校(麻省理工)简介,机床说明书翻译及丰富多彩的校园词汇等。
